'Ergo' range
'Ergo' range was recalled on 23 March 2018 under EU Safety Gate alert A12/0432/18. Entrapment, Strangulation risk reported by France. The are gaps, spaces and sharp edges at different parts of the cot.

Risk Description
The are gaps, spaces and sharp edges at different parts of the cot. The locking system can break, creating a gap, and there are protruding corners. Children could insert fingers or limbs into the gaps and get them stuck or crushed. Moreover, they could introduce their head into certain gaps, or their garments could get caught, leading to strangulation.The product does not comply with the relevant European Standard EN 716.
Measures Taken
Type of economic operator to whom the measure(s) were ordered: ManufacturerCategory of measure(s): Recall of the product from end usersDate of entry into force: 07/02/2018Type of economic operator to whom the measure(s) were ordered: ManufacturerCategory of measure(s): Destruction of the productDate of entry into force: 07/02/2018
Product Description
Cot for use in crèches, 120 x 60 cm.
